In reply to: [Longevity] Audit says Home page isn’t mobile friendlyI followed up with Dreamhost and got more input on this:
The message you’re receiving: “Your homepage is wider than 360 pixels and doesn’t have a mobile domain…” It is tied to how the plugin detects responsive design. The plugin performs a basic screen-width and mobile-domain check, and flags anything beyond 360px or without a separate mobile URL.
However, our team also tested your site using tools like SpeedVitals and found that: The site doesn’t fully meet modern mobile performance expectations. There may be layout or responsiveness limitations that cause elements to render poorly on certain viewports. Here is the full SpeedVitals report for your mobile version of the site: https://app.speedvitals.com/report/be-joy.com/co7JUx/
This is likely not a false positive. Instead, it appears your theme may lack full mobile responsiveness, particularly under 360px, which can cause display or usability issues on smaller mobile screens. This aligns with both the SEO plugin’s alert and external tests. The Next recommended Steps are contacting the theme developer or considering a mobile-optimized alternative.
